SCD Diet Resources

The Specific Carbohydrate Diet™ (SCD) is used by parents of autistic children who are trying to deal with yeast issue through dietary intervention.

Pecanbread.com – This is a very comprehensive site on all things SCD. The specific carbohydrate diet (SCD) has been helpful for many people with severe gastrointestinal disorders (Chrone’s, Celiac, Ulcerative Colitis, ect..). It is not a lifelong diet. It is for healing the gut & starving out microorganisms. Some parents are using it for autism with success.
